如何使用CSS制作下载小图标
在现代网页设计中,小图标扮演着至关重要的角色,它们不仅能够提升网页的视觉吸引力,还能引导用户进行特定的操作,如下载文件、应用程序或资源。今天,我们将深入探讨如何使用CSS制作一个引人注目的下载小图标,并通过一系列设计技巧和策略,让你的下载按钮更加诱人,从而促使更多用户点击。
一、为什么需要下载小图标
在网页上,下载小图标和按钮不仅是功能性的存在,更是用户交互体验的重要组成部分。一个设计得当的下载图标能够瞬间吸引用户的注意力,清晰传达出“点击这里下载”的信息,从而引导用户执行预期的操作。此外,图标和按钮的视觉效果也能反映出一个品牌的风格和专业度,有助于塑造品牌形象。
二、CSS制作下载小图标的步骤
1. 基础形状与颜色
首先,我们使用HTML和CSS创建一个基础形状,比如一个常见的向下箭头,这通常被视为下载图标的象征。你可以通过CSS的`border`属性创建一个三角形箭头,或者使用``标签插入矢量图形。为了让图标更具吸引力,你可以选择品牌的主色调或互补色作为图标颜色,以增强视觉冲击力。
```css
.download-icon {
width: 0;
height: 0;
border-left: 10px solid transparent;
border-right: 10px solid transparent;
border-top: 20px solid 007BFF; /* 示例颜色 */
```
2. 添加细节
在基础形状上,你可以进一步添加细节,如一个圆形背景、一些阴影效果或是一个小小的文件图标,以丰富图标的视觉层次。这些元素可以通过CSS的`box-shadow`、`border-radius`和`position`属性来实现。
```css
.download-icon-wrapper {
display: inline-block;
position: relative;
width: 40px;
height: 40px;
border-radius: 50%;
background-color: EEF5FF; /* 示例背景色 */
box-shadow: 0 2px 4px rgba(0, 0, 0, 0.1);
.download-icon-wrapper .download-icon {
position: absolute;
top: 50%;
left: 50%;
transform: translate(-50%, -50%);
```
3. 动态效果
为了进一步增强图标的吸引力,你可以添加一些动态效果,如悬停时的颜色变化、旋转动画或轻微的放大效果。这些效果可以通过CSS的`:hover`伪类和`@keyframes`规则来实现。
```css
.download-icon-wrapper:hover {
background-color: CFE2FF; /* 悬停时的背景色 */
transform: scale(1.1); /* 轻微的放大效果 */
transition: background-color 0.3s, transform 0.3s;
@keyframes rotate-arrow {
from {
transform: translate(-50%, -50%) rotate(0deg);
to {
transform: translate(-50%, -50%) rotate(360deg);
.download-icon-wrapper:hover .download-icon {
animation: rotate-arrow 0.5s linear infinite; /* 旋转动画 */
```
三、如何使下载小图标更具吸引力
1. 结合品牌元素
在设计下载图标时,确保它与你的品牌风格和配色方案保持一致。使用品牌的主色调、辅助色或标志性图形元素,能够让图标更加显眼且易于识别,从而增强用户对品牌的记忆和认同感。
2. 明确指向性
下载图标应具有明确的指向性,即用户一眼就能看出这是一个下载按钮。除了使用向下的箭头,你还可以尝试其他具有象征意义的图形,如一个磁盘图标加上一个箭头,或者一个带有“下载”文字的按钮。这些设计元素都能有效地传达下载的功能性。
3. 添加文字说明
虽然图标本身已经足够直观,但添加简短的文字说明(如“下载”或“免费下载”)可以进一步提高图标的清晰度。确保文字与图标在视觉风格和大小上保持协调,避免过于突兀或难以阅读。
4. 考虑用户行为
在设计下载图标时,要充分考虑用户的点击习惯和行为路径。通常,用户会寻找页面上的显眼位置(如右上角或页面底部)来寻找下载按钮。确保你的图标位于用户容易发现的位置,并考虑使用引导性的视觉元素(如箭头或手指图标)来引导用户点击。
5. 利用视觉层次
通过对比和视觉层次,使下载图标在页面上脱颖而出。你可以使用颜色、大小、形状和位置等视觉元素来创建焦点,吸引用户的注意力。确保图标足够大且颜色鲜明,以便在各种设备和屏幕尺寸上都能清晰显示。
6. 测试与优化
最后,不要忽视测试与优化这一环节。通过A/B测试或用户反馈,了解不同设计元素对用户行为的影响,并根据测试结果进行调整和优化。记住,设计是一个不断迭代和改进的过程,只有不断地测试和学习,才能创造出最佳的用户体验。
四、结论
通过巧妙地使用CSS,你可以轻松创建一个既美观又实用的下载小图标。但更重要的是,你需要考虑如何使这个图标更加吸引人,从而促使更多用户点击。结合品牌元素、明确指向性、添加文字说明、考虑用户行为、利用视觉层次以及测试与优化,这些策略将帮助你设计出一个既符合品牌形象又能有效提升用户点击率的下载图标。
在现代网页设计中,细节决定成败。一个精心设计的下载图标不仅能够提升用户体验,还能为你的品牌带来更多的曝光和下载量。因此,不妨花些时间和精力来打磨你的下载图标设计,让它成为你网站或应用中的一个小亮点吧!
- 上一篇: 揭秘:轻松学会查看QQ实名认证信息的方法
- 下一篇: 轻松获取!免费申请QQ号的实用指南
-
轻松掌握:动态网站制作实战小教程资讯攻略10-31
-
全面掌握DIV使用技巧与CSS样式控制指南资讯攻略11-14
-
如何在浏览器中查看网页的HTML和CSS源代码?资讯攻略12-07
-
如何关闭小熊直播的自动播放功能资讯攻略11-30
-
高效学习CSS的方法与技巧资讯攻略11-08
-
如何使用时间机器字幕制作软件添加视频字幕资讯攻略11-09